The ROAD to Housing Act: What It Means for Local Governments
Public Law 119-101 attaches new conditions to CDBG, scores housing production in higher-cost entitlement communities, and authorizes a family of competitive grants that reward documented reform. The jurisdictions that win will be the ones whose records already prove it.
Florida's Permitting Reset: HB 803, HB 927, and the New Operating Discipline for Local Government
Florida's 2026 permitting laws are not just about a $7,500 permit exemption. HB 803 and HB 927 create new workflow demands around intake, review clocks, private-provider coordination, development review, fee treatment, and documentation.
